Hyperspectral infrared facts may be used for comparison of inversion of surface area emissivity [133], detection of coal combustion dynamics and coal hearth propagation course [134], detection of spatiotemporal distribution of surface area soil moisture [135], and estimation of floor temperature [136]. Furthermore, the distant LWIR can detect the emissivity of the floor substance, that may be acquired from the radiance calculated by the sensor. Consequently, LWIR hyperspectral imaging sensors deliver precious info for various armed forces, scientific, and professional programs [137]. Hyperspectral remote sensing technological know-how also can distinguish plant species based upon plant-precise reflectivity. Comparing the retrieved emissivity spectrum Together with the laboratory reference spectrum and afterwards employing a random classifier for species identification, experiments have proven that the thermal infrared imaging spectrum permits quick and spatial measurement of spectral plant emissivity by having an accuracy similar to laboratory measurements, and presents complementary details for plant species identification [138].

Infrared is often a variety of electromagnetic wave. If the temperature of an objects is earlier mentioned the thermodynamic complete temperature, infrared radiation occurs. Thermal infrared imaging usually refers to mid-infrared imaging and far-infrared imaging. Thermal imaging is the usage of infrared detectors and optical imaging objectives, getting the infrared radiation Electrical power on the measured goal, and reflecting its distribution sample to the photosensitive factor in the infrared detector; the detector sends information and facts to the electronic components on the sensor, impression processing, thus acquiring infrared thermal illustrations or photos [one]. Infrared thermal imaging is usually a non-damaging and non-contact detection technologies, which was initial utilized in the armed forces subject [two]. It is split into refrigeration type and uncooled sort infrared technologies. The refrigeration style infrared thermal imager was used in the laboratory inside the early stage due to the somewhat massive quantity of the refrigeration tools. The study of the refrigeration form imager is while in the areas of strengthening the Doing the job temperature, very long wave detection, and technique integration.
